Three men who beat the Olympic champion in figure skating Dmitry Solovyov face prison terms. The correspondent of “Lenta.ru” informs about it.

A criminal case was initiated against the attackers under article 112 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ation (“Intentional infliction of moderate severity of harm to health, committed by a group of persons out of hooligan motives”). It provides for imprisonment for up to five years.

If the state of health of Solovyov begins to deteriorate, the article may be re-qualified to a more serious one – 113 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ation (“Intentional infliction of grievous bodily harm, committed by a group of persons out of hooligan motives”). According to it, the attackers will face up to 12 years in prison.

On December 21, an athlete was beaten in Moscow by three men when he stood up for his girlfriend, curler Anna Sidorova. The press service of the Main Directorate of the Ministry of Internal Affairs in Moscow reported that the attackers were detained.

Soloviev performed in ice dancing with Ekaterina Bobrova. Together they became 2014 Olympic champions and 2018 Olympic silver medalists in team competition.
